Job Description:

This role is based at Blantyre Health Centre within the Specialist Palliative Care Service covering NHS Lanarkshire. The Senior Advanced Practitioner will provide advanced clinical care and management for both stable and acutely unwell patients and their families, making autonomous, complex decisions using expert skills and knowledge.

The post involves assessing care needs, delivering advanced care, and acting within professional boundaries to provide comprehensive patient care from history taking to diagnosis, treatment, and evaluation. The role requires competence across all four pillars of advanced practice and autonomous decision-making.

The successful candidate will manage assessment, examination, diagnosis, management, and treatment initiation for adults.
